What's The Definition Of Plonk?

[n] the noise of something dropping (as into liquid)
[n] (British and Australian) a cheap wine of inferior quality
[v] set (something or oneself) down; "He planked the money on the table"; "He planked himself into the sofa"

Synonyms | Synonyms for Plonk: flump | plank | plop | plump | plump down | plunk | plunk down
